Spark SQL五大关联策略

选择连接策略的核心原则是尽量避免shuffle和sort的操作,因为这些操作性能开销很大,比较吃资源且耗时,所以首选的连接策略是不需要shuffle和sort的hash连接策略。◦Broadcast Hash Join(BHJ):广播散列连接◦Shuffle Hash Join(SHJ):洗牌散列连

docker-compose部署kafka单机和集群

从 3.3 版本后,Kafka 引入了 KRaft 来替代 ZooKeeper,所以我们不必再部署 zk 了。选择集群切换 -> 新增集群,填好配置后,选择切换,就可以管理我们的 kafka 集群了。这里部署了 3 个 Broker,即 Kafka1、Kafka2 和 Kafka3。我们之后测试肯定

【RabbitMQ】延迟队列之死信交换机

延迟队列是一种特殊类型的消息队列,它允许将消息在一定的延迟时间后才被消费。在传统的消息队列中,消息一旦发送到队列中就会立即被消费者获取并处理。而延迟队列则提供了一种延迟消息处理的机制。

移动安全面试题—hook技术

Substrate 是一个跨平台的代码修改框架,支持 Android、iOS、macOS 和 Linux 等平台。它允许开发者在运行时修改目标程序的行为。实现原理:Substrate 的 hook 实现方式包括 Inline Hook 和 trampoline 技术。在 Android 平台上,Su

2024年【金属非金属矿山(地下矿山)安全管理人员】报名考试及金属非金属矿山(地下矿山)安全管理人员考试技巧

2024年金属非金属矿山(地下矿山)安全管理人员报名考试为正在备考金属非金属矿山(地下矿山)安全管理人员操作证的学员准备的理论考试专题,每个月更新的金属非金属矿山(地下矿山)安全管理人员考试技巧祝您顺利通过金属非金属矿山(地下矿山)安全管理人员考试。49、【单选题】非煤矿山企业取得安全生产许可证后,

【Linux的基本指令】

世上有两种耀眼的光芒,一种是正在升起的太阳,一种是正在努力学习编程的你!一个爱学编程的人。各位看官,我衷心的希望这篇博客能对你们有所帮助,同时也希望各位看官能对我的文章给与点评,希望我们能够携手共同促进进步,在编程的道路上越走越远!提示:以下是本篇文章正文内容,下面案例可供参考好了,本篇博客到这里就

Linux环境下OpenSSH升级到 OpenSSH_9.5p1(内置保姆级教程)

我最近在修复服务器的openssh漏洞的时候是服务器生产环境,自己在做的时候,就遇到的重启之后直接断掉ssh的连接,最后发现原因是没配置sshd_config的允许远程用户登录,因此,在此记录一下升级openssh的操作步骤,希望能够帮到初学者。

云计算未来展望:边缘计算、量子计算与AI

云计算的未来展望是多元化的,边缘计算、量子计算和人工智能都将发挥关键作用。这些趋势不仅将改变我们的日常生活,还将推动科学研究、商业和社会的发展。因此,了解和跟踪这些趋势对于个人和企业都至关重要。云计算行业将继续为创新提供无限潜力,我们可以期待更多令人振奋的发展。😊🙏Java面试技巧Java面试八

【Docker】镜像的构建与上传下载阿里云

我们在使用Docker的时候,用着别人的镜像总是差点意思又或者说会有环境差异导致的潜在问题,为了避免这些问题我们可以自行构建镜像,并且将镜像上传阿里云镜像仓库方便拉取

一文解读Docker 网络Network

Docker网络是Docker容器之间和容器与外部网络之间的通信和连接的一种机制。在Docker中,每个容器都可以有自己的网络栈,包括网络接口、IP地址和网络配置。Docker网络提供了一种灵活且可定制的方式,使得容器之间可以相互通信,并与主机或其他网络资源进行交互。在docker中,重启后ip是会

【配置Omni-Swarm(omni swarm:开源的多机器人协同CSLAM算法)更新中】

配置Omni-swarm环境,跑通Omni-swarm。Omni-swarm是一种用于空中群体的分布式全向视觉惯性超宽带(visual-inertial-UWB)状态估计系统。

如何基于Flink实现定制化功能的开发

技术为需求服务,通用需求由开源软件提供功能,一些特殊的需求,需要基于场景定制化开发功能。而对于自定义开发功能,Flink则提供了这样的SDK接口能力。本文将从定制化功能需求分析和如何基于Flink构建定制化需求功能两个方面分享描述。

为什么前端数值精度会丢失?(BigInt解决办法)

数值计算、保留指定小数位、接口返回数值过大等等,这些操作都有可能导致原本正常的数值在JavaScript中确表现得异常(即精度丢失)。使用整数进行计算(先放大再缩小)。在处理需要高精度计算的场景中,可以使用一些专门的库或工具。例如,JavaScript中的Decimal.js、Big.js或BigN

前端常见的时间转换方法,获取当前时间方法

前端常见的时间转换方法,获取当前时间方法

【Docker】安装Nginx容器并部署前后端分离项目

Nginx一站式安装并结合网络通讯让各个容器之间可以相互访问,随后部署前后端项目使其负载均衡!!

JWT 单点登录探析:原理、用途与安全实践

JWT (JSON Web Token) 是目前最流行的跨域认证解决方案,是。从 JWT 的全称可以看出,JWT 本身也是 Token,一种规范化之后的 JSON 结构的 Token。通过数字签名的方式,以 JSON 对象为载体,在不同的服务终端之间安全的传输信息。JWT,因此,我们的。这显然增加了

探索SQL性能优化之道:实用技巧与最佳实践

2021年我和博文视点合作了一本技术类型的书籍“Spring Cloud Alibaba微服务架构实战派上下册”,它是我涉足知识输出领域以来的第一本书,同时它也是我自己积累的技术池中部分技术的产出。为了写好那本书,我几乎花费了所有的休息时间,并主动的承担了书的售后技术辅导和咨询的职责(几乎是有问必答

工作中常用的 git 命令

(按 i 进行编辑,编辑后,按 ESC,如果保存退出使用 :wq,只退出输入 :q,如果出错,退出不保存使用 :qa!git commit --amend #该命令将打开编辑器,并允许更改最后一次提交消息。

layui弹框(上)- 基础参数:弹出层、多按钮、对齐方式、遮罩层(透明度)、定时关闭...的集合

layui弹出层layer的标题、内容、引用页面、自定义样式、多按钮调用方法、回调函数、遮罩、定时关闭、动画效果、拉伸拖拽等

开发安全之:XML Injection

XML injection 更为严重的情况下,攻击者可以添加 XML 元素,更改身份验证凭据或修改 XML 电子商务数据库中的价格。XML Injection 之所以不同于 XML External Entity (XXE) Injection,是因为攻击者通常会控制插入到 XML 文档中部或末尾的

个人信息

加入时间:2021-12-08

最后活动:2024-12-14 03:06:47

发帖数:162866

回复数:0